Hearty Cowboy Breakfast Casserole Recipe

This cowboy breakfast casserole brings big, bold breakfast flavors right to your table. It’s perfect for a weekend brunch or a satisfying morning meal with minimal fuss.Cowboy Breakfast Casserole

Key Ingredients & Tips for Cowboy Breakfast

  • Meat Options: You can use ground sausage, bacon, or even diced ham in your cowboy breakfast casserole. Pick your favorite!
  • Veggie Boost: Add diced bell peppers or onions to the mix for extra color and nutrition. Just sauté them before adding.

What You Need for Cowboy Casserole

  • 1 lb ground sausage
  • 6 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up shredded Monterey Jack cheese
  • 1 can (10.5 oz) condensed cream of mushroom soup
  • Salt and pepper to taste

⏱️ Time: 15 min prep, 35 min cook🍽️ Yields: 6-8 servings

How to Make This Cowboy Breakfast

Step 1: Prep & Brown Meat

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Brown the ground sausage in a large skillet over medium heat, breaking it up as it cooks. Drain any extra grease and set the sausage aside.

Step 2: Mix Ingredients

In a large bowl, beat the eggs and milk together. Stir in the cooked sausage, both types of cheese, and the cream of mushroom soup. Mix everything until it’s well combined. Season with salt and pepper.

Step 3: Bake Casserole

Pour the mixture into a 9×13 inch baking dish that you’ve greased lightly. Bake for 35-40 minutes, or until the casserole is set in the center and golden brown on top.

📝 Final Note for Cowboy Breakfast

This cowboy breakfast casserole tastes great with a dollop of sour cream or some salsa on the side. Leftovers store well in the fridge for up to 3 days.

Easy Crack Breakfast Casserole with Tater Tots

If you love tater tots, this easy breakfast casserole is for you! It’s a comforting dish loaded with flavor, making mornings extra special and delicious.Crack Breakfast Casserole Tater Tot

Key Ingredients & Tips for Tater Tot Casserole

  • Crispy Tots: For extra crispy tater tots, you can bake them separately for 10-15 minutes before adding them to the casserole mix. This helps prevent soggy bottoms.
  • Cheese Blend: Try a mix of sharp cheddar and Colby Jack cheese for a deeper taste and a gooey texture.

What You Need for Tater Tot Casserole

  • 1 lb ground sausage or bacon, cooked and crumbled
  • 1 bag (32 oz) frozen tater tots
  • 8 large eggs
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up chopped green onions (optional)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

⏱️ Time: 20 min prep, 45 min cook🍽️ Yields: 8-10 servings

How to Make This Tater Tot Breakfast

Step 1: Get Ready

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a 9×13 inch baking dish. If using sausage, brown and drain it now.

Step 2: Layer & Mix

Spread half of the frozen tater tots in the bottom of the prepared dish. Top with the cooked sausage or bacon and half of the cheese. Add the remaining tater tots. In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, salt, and pepper. Pour this egg mixture evenly over the layers in the dish.

Step 3: Bake & Finish

Bake for 30 minutes. Then, sprinkle the remaining cheese and green onions (if using) over the top. Bake for another 15-20 minutes, or until the eggs are set and the tater tots are golden.

📝 Final Note for Tater Tot Casserole

Let this tater tot breakfast casserole sit for a few minutes after baking before slicing. This helps it hold together better and makes serving easier.
